Northwest Middle School Overview

About This School

Northwest Middle School is a public middle in Jackson, Mississippi, serving 242 students in grades Grade 6-8.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 61% in ELA and 53% in math. The school maintains a 10:1 student-teacher ratio with 23 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$53,698. Support services include a counselor-to-student ratio of 80:1. Students at Northwest Middle School are predominantly Black, representing 95% of the population, with 3% identifying as Hispanic and 1% as White. The student body is composed of 58% female and 42% male.
